Japanese stilt grass
A species of annual grass native to Asia, often considered invasive elsewhere. Scientific name: Microstegium vimineum.
アシボソは林床に広がる一年草だ。
Japanese stilt grass is an annual plant that spreads across forest floors.
The name アシボソ (脚細) literally means 'thin legs', likely referring to the slender stems of the grass. The exact origin of the name is uncertain.
